About the role

  • Create and implement annual and 3-year growth plans, with detailed revenue and market share targets
  • Identify and execute initiatives for new programs and product launches
  • Build strong relationships with corporate and regional stakeholders within national accounts
  • Negotiate pricing, rebates, and Go-To-Market strategies
  • Represent Husqvarna at regional and national trade shows
  • Achieve or exceed sales targets through data-driven decision-making
  • Analyze account performance and publish monthly health dashboards
  • Conduct corporate and regional business reviews with key decision-makers
  • Maintain account activities in CRM and ensure accurate expense reporting
  • Partner with Marketing on promotional plans and product commercialization
  • Provide input on product development and category improvements
  • Drive alignment between national goals and regional execution

Requirements

  • Minimum of 4 years’ sales experience required
  • High school diploma or GED required; Bachelor’s degree in Business or related field preferred
  • Solid skills in negotiation, relationship-building, and sales analytics
  • Advanced proficiency in CRM systems, Excel, and sales forecasting
  • Experience in analytics-based sales organizations
Benefits
  • Competitive compensation and performance-based incentives
  • Benefits, including medical, dental, and vision insurance at date of hire
  • A 401(k) with matching and no vesting
  • An employee purchase discount on Husqvarna products
  • An education assistance program
  • Paid parental leave
  • Eleven paid holidays
  • Paid vacation
